Questions people ask

What’s the difference from PDF to Word?

PDF to Text gives the plain words with no formatting, perfect for search, scripts or pasting elsewhere. PDF to Word rebuilds an editable document with headings, tables and images. Choose by whether you want the content or the layout.

Does it work on scanned PDFs?

Yes. If the page is an image with no embedded text, OCR recognizes the words so you still get usable text instead of an empty file.

Is the reading order preserved?

The words are regrouped by their position on the page and read left to right, top to bottom, so an ordinary single-column document comes out in real reading order instead of the jumbled order the PDF stores internally. Pages laid out in several columns that share the same lines, such as a newspaper or journal page, can still interleave, so give those a quick check.
